You only get a choice when settings (hearing aids/database) don’t match. The first time you must choose hearing aid settings because your database is empty.

At (End Fitting Step) if you save to Both (database and hearing aids) then both will match and you no longer will have to choose because both are the same.

In Genie, your left hearing aid appears on the right side of the monitor screen. Can this be changed? What determines the diameter of the vent in the earbud. I have 0.7 mm. I greet all forum members

1 Like

No it cannot be changed. It is designed to relate to the audiologist view of his/her client. You can get comfortable with that view after some time. Just imagine a person sitting across from you.

What’s an earbud?

This is determined by your hearing loss, at .7mm that’s pretty small, most likely for severe to profound loss, posting your audiogram will help.
